About this episode

Caroline Stanbury sits down with renowned entrepreneur and jewelry designer Jennifer Fisher for a no-holds-barred conversation about the reality of founding and growing a successful brand. From late nights and self-doubt to bold risks and breakthrough moments, Jennifer shares the unfiltered truth behind her journey—and the grit it takes to keep going. Caroline brings her own lens on reinvention, resilience, and building a brand in the spotlight. This episode is an honest, empowering look at what it really takes to be a founder.
